Undo the two 8mm bolts at the top and it should just slide up and out... Check the big black plug on the top, that's the normal one that suffers with water...

Before you get stuck in, worth checking the Radio fuse (no 8, a 5amp, at the front on my '02). I blew mine by accident and it knocked out all sound and the radio itself! .

Try taking each of the plug connectors off the amplifier and spraying the plugs and sockets with a liberal dose of electrical contact cleaner.

Niceday, can you post a picture of your amp. I may have a replacement. Need to see what connections you have. I had 3 broken pins caused by corrosion and had to replace the amp. Took it all apart first to try adn fix but the connector units are not able to be removed AFAIK. in any case would involve a new pin and re-solder with very little space to work in. |
